Down Syndrome
A genetic disorder caused by the presence of all or part of a third copy of chromosome 21, characterized by developmental delays and physical features such as a flat facial profile.
Skin Pigmentation
The coloring of the skin caused by the presence of melanin, which can vary greatly among individuals and populations.
Phenotype
The observable physical or biochemical characteristics of an organism, as determined by both genetic makeup and environmental influences.
Height
A measurement of a person or object from base to top or head to foot in either a lying or standing position.
